SLA and Latency Metrics

Mastering SLA and Latency Metrics: A Deep Dive into Network Performance and Guarantees

In today's interconnected digital landscape, the seamless operation of applications and services hinges on two critical factors: Service Level Agreements (SLAs) and Network Latency. These aren't just technical jargon; they are fundamental pillars that dictate user experience, business continuity, and operational efficiency. Understanding the intricate relationship between SLA and Latency Metrics is paramount for any organization striving to deliver high-performance, reliable services, whether in cloud computing, gaming, or enterprise networks.

This comprehensive guide explores the definitions, measurement techniques, and the profound impact of these metrics, providing insights into how to monitor, optimize, and ensure compliance for superior digital experiences.

What is a Service Level Agreement (SLA)?

A Service Level Agreement (SLA) is a contractual commitment between a service provider and a customer. It defines the level of service expected from the provider, outlining specific metrics by which that service is measured, and the penalties or remedies for non-compliance. Beyond simple uptime guarantees, modern SLAs encompass a broader range of performance metrics, including availability, response times, and incident resolution times. For instance, an SLA might guarantee 99.9% uptime, meaning the service will be available almost constantly.

Key components often found in an SLA include:

  • Service Availability: The percentage of time a service is operational and accessible.
  • Performance Benchmarks: Specific targets for speed, capacity, or latency.
  • Incident Response & Resolution Times: How quickly issues are acknowledged and resolved.
  • Security Measures: Commitments to data protection and privacy.
  • Reporting and Monitoring: How service levels will be tracked and reported.

Adhering to SLA compliance is crucial for maintaining trust and avoiding financial repercussions. It forms the backbone of reliability for crucial services, from SaaS platforms to critical infrastructure.

Understanding Latency Metrics

Latency, in simple terms, is the delay before a transfer of data begins following an instruction for its transfer. It’s the time it takes for a data packet to travel from its source to its destination and back. High latency leads to noticeable delays, often referred to as "lag," which severely degrades user experience in real-time applications like video conferencing, online gaming, and financial trading platforms.

There are various types of latency:

  • Propagation Latency: The time it takes for a signal to travel across a physical distance. This is limited by the speed of light.
  • Transmission Latency: The time required to push all bits of a packet into the wire.
  • Processing Latency: The time taken by network devices (routers, switches) to process packet headers and determine the next hop.
  • Queuing Latency: The time a packet waits in a queue before being processed or transmitted, often due to network congestion.

Measuring network latency typically involves tools like ping, traceroute, and specialized network monitoring solutions. For a better understanding of how geographical distance impacts network performance, especially in relation to user experience across different regions, you might find it helpful to explore resources like ping test europe, which illustrates regional latency variations. Lower latency is always desirable, as it ensures quicker data transfer and more responsive applications.

The Critical Relationship Between SLA and Latency

The relationship between SLA and Latency Metrics is symbiotic. An SLA often includes specific thresholds for acceptable latency. For example, a cloud provider might guarantee that the latency to its servers from a specific region will not exceed 50ms 99.9% of the time. Meeting these guaranteed latency SLA targets is crucial for service providers to avoid breaches and for customers to ensure their critical applications perform as expected.

Failure to meet latency SLAs can have significant consequences::

  • Financial Penalties: Service credits or refunds to customers.
  • Reputational Damage: Loss of customer trust and market standing.
  • Operational Disruptions: Poor application performance, leading to lost productivity or sales.
  • User Dissatisfaction: Frustration and abandonment of services due to slow response times.

For applications that demand ultra-low latency, such as high-frequency trading or competitive online gaming, even a few milliseconds can make a substantial difference. Optimizing network infrastructure, choosing appropriate server regions, and using high-bandwidth connections are all strategies aimed at achieving and maintaining stringent latency SLAs.

Beyond Basic Latency: Jitter and Packet Loss

While raw latency is a key indicator, a comprehensive understanding of network performance metrics requires looking at related factors like jitter and packet loss. These metrics further quantify the quality of a network connection and are often indirectly addressed within an SLA's broader performance clauses.

Jitter: Jitter refers to the variation in the delay of received packets. In other words, it’s the inconsistency of latency. While a steady, high latency might be tolerable in some scenarios, fluctuating latency (high jitter) is disastrous for real-time communication protocols like VoIP or video streaming, leading to choppy audio and distorted video.

Packet Loss: Packet loss occurs when one or more packets of data traveling across a computer network fail to reach their destination. This can happen due to network congestion, hardware issues, or faulty wiring. Lost packets must often be retransmitted, which increases overall latency and reduces effective throughput.

Both jitter and packet loss directly impact the user experience, often more severely than consistent latency within acceptable bounds. Therefore, robust SLAs for real-time applications will often have specific clauses addressing these critical network health indicators. Achieving optimal performance also involves considering factors like wireless technologies; understanding the differences, for example, between 5GHz vs 2.4GHz Ping can be crucial for minimizing latency and jitter in a Wi-Fi environment.

Monitoring and Optimization for SLA Compliance and Low Latency

Effective latency monitoring tools and robust strategies are essential to ensure consistent SLA compliance. Organizations utilize a variety of tools and techniques to track, analyze, and optimize their network performance:

  • Network Performance Monitoring (NPM) Tools: These provide real-time visibility into network health, tracking latency, jitter, packet loss, and bandwidth usage.
  • Application Performance Monitoring (APM) Tools: Focus on the performance of applications, often revealing latency issues originating within the application stack itself rather than just the network.
  • Synthetic Monitoring: Simulating user interactions to proactively identify performance bottlenecks and potential SLA breaches.
  • Real User Monitoring (RUM): Collecting performance data from actual user sessions to understand real-world latency experiences.

Optimization strategies for improving SLA compliance and optimizing for low latency include:

  • Content Delivery Networks (CDNs): Caching content closer to end-users to reduce propagation latency.
  • Edge Computing: Processing data closer to the source, minimizing the need to send data to centralized cloud servers.
  • Network Upgrades: Investing in higher bandwidth, lower-latency infrastructure.
  • Traffic Prioritization (QoS): Ensuring critical applications receive preferential treatment on the network.
  • Server Location Optimization: Placing servers in geographical regions closer to the majority of users to reduce physical distance. This is a vital consideration for performance-sensitive applications, and you can learn more about making informed decisions for optimal connectivity by reviewing resources on the Best Server Region for Gaming, which highlights the impact of server proximity on latency.

Conclusion

In an era where digital services are integral to daily life and business operations, the combination of SLA and Latency Metrics stands as a benchmark for quality and reliability. Service Level Agreements provide the necessary contractual framework, while the measurement and optimization of latency ensure that those agreements translate into tangible, high-performance experiences for end-users. By diligently monitoring these metrics, understanding their interdependencies, and implementing proactive optimization strategies, organizations can guarantee robust service delivery, foster customer loyalty, and thrive in the competitive digital landscape.